Local library / Native output / Long-term care

Local HiFi ECHO Next

An open-source desktop music player for local libraries, HiFi output, and long-term maintainability. Library scans, covers, lyrics, queueing, and native audio output stay in clear boundaries.

Quick links Changelog Docs GitHub
ECHO Next 手绘风格主视觉
Local music library / HiFi output
ECHO Next 曲库首页界面截图
01
Local library

Folder scans, SQLite library storage, tags, cover cache, and album grouping for large collections.

02
Native output

WASAPI Shared / Exclusive, ASIO, sample-rate state, and bit-perfect hints with a clear signal path.

03
Cloud library

Supports SMB, Navidrome, Baidu Netdisk, and other remote library sources while keeping network files inside a clear playback boundary.

04
Diagnostics

Logs, crash recovery, library health, cache migration, and settings backup make issues traceable.

Library, full scale

From folder scanning to album walls, from tags to cover cache, ECHO Next treats large-library browsing as a core capability. Screenshots are from the real app, not staged promo art.

Library

Folders, album wall, songs, likes, history, and playlists are organized around local files.

Output

System output, WASAPI, ASIO, EQ, preamp, and sample-rate state each have a clear place.

Boundary

Renderer handles UI; main process and native hosts own playback, scans, cache, and system integration.

ECHO Next 专辑墙和曲库界面截图
What ECHO actually does

Not an empty shell. A local-music and DSP control center.

The homepage should surface the real product: local library, native output, professional DSP, lyrics and MV, remote sources, plugins, and diagnostics built for long-term use.

Library core

Local music stays first

Folders, songs, album walls, artists, inbox, likes, history, playlists, and duplicate checks are organized around local files instead of online-platform assumptions.

  • SQLite library
  • Cover cache
  • Tag reading
  • Large-library browsing
Audio output

A signal path you can read

System output, WASAPI Shared / Exclusive, ASIO, ReplayGain, sample-rate state, and bit-perfect hints each have a clear place; DSP is marked when active, and native direct path stays clear when it is off.

  • WASAPI
  • ASIO
  • ReplayGain
  • Bit-perfect state
Lyrics & MV

Lyrics and MV stay controllable

Local lyrics, online candidates, translations, romanization, kana enhancement, per-track offsets, and MV matching live in a flow that users can correct.

  • Candidate matching
  • Translation display
  • Lyric offsets
  • External playback boundary
Remote sources

Remote is an extension, not a lock-in

WebDAV, Jellyfin, Emby, SMB, SSHFS, Subsonic, Navidrome, and cloud sources can enter the same browsing and playback experience without replacing local ownership.

  • SMB / WebDAV
  • Jellyfin / Emby
  • Subsonic
  • Remote indexing
Plugins

Expandable without losing boundaries

Plugins, downloaders, network metadata, streaming search, and remote background tasks run behind controlled permission and task boundaries.

  • Permission model
  • Plugin logs
  • Import / export
  • Task boundaries
Diagnostics

Problems should be traceable

Logs, crash recovery, library health, cache migration, settings backup, and dangerous-action confirmation give long-term maintenance a practical escape route.

  • Log export
  • Cache migration
  • Health checks
  • Settings backup
Recommended path

From the first track to the full library.

ECHO Next is not about switching everything on at once. It behaves more like a stable desktop setup: confirm local playback first, then add output, lyrics, remote sources, and plugins.

  1. 01 Start with a small folder

    Confirm scan, artwork, playback, and lyrics before importing the whole collection.

  2. 02 Shape the browsing view

    Use songs, albums, artists, folders, inbox, and history to recover the collection map.

  3. 03 Tune the output path

    Choose system output, WASAPI, or ASIO, then check sample-rate and bit-perfect state.

  4. 04 Add experience layers

    Bring in lyrics, MV, artwork, metadata, remote sources, downloaders, and plugins when needed.

Renderer

UI, lists, lyrics, MV, settings, and player controls.

Preload / IPC

Controlled API boundary between UI and native power.

Main services

Scans, SQLite, cache, plugins, remote sources, and diagnostics.

Native hosts

WASAPI, ASIO, device state, low-latency output, and recovery.

Latest version

ECHO 26.6.4 · Jun 04, 2026

Docs written for use

Install, quick start, audio output, library management, and troubleshooting live in the docs. The writing explains boundaries and tradeoffs instead of filling the page with decorative slogans.

Read docs
  1. 01 Install
  2. 02 Quick start
  3. 03 Audio output
  4. 04 Library
  5. 05 Troubleshooting
Powered by Moekotori

Bring every library within reach.

Local files, SMB, Navidrome, Baidu Netdisk, and more remote sources can live in one library view. ECHO Next organizes, plays, and routes them so the collection feels close again.

View updates
ECHO Next hand-drawn brand illustration